Dracula - A Feminist Revenge Fantasy San Francisco Playhouse Tickets & Info
Experience the powerful reimagining of the classic legend with Dracula - A Feminist Revenge Fantasy, premiering in San Francisco on June 25, 2026. This provocative theatrical production explores themes of female empowerment and resistance through innovative storytelling techniques, including shadow puppetry and marionettes, which add visual depth and symbolic richness to the narrative. Developed by the renowned UK company imitating the dog, known for their pioneering use of electronic media in theater, the play engages audiences with a fresh perspective on gender dynamics and revenge. Prior to the performance, cast members participate in discussions on gender equality and dramaturgy, deepening the audience's understanding of the play’s social commentary. As the show unfolds, viewers are invited to witness a bold reinterpretation of Dracula, emphasizing feminist resistance and reclaiming agency.
